Data Bridge Market Research analyses that the feed non-protein nitrogen market will project a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.30% during the forecast period of 2022-2029 and is likely to reach USD 1.81 Billion in 2029.

The feed non-protein nitrogen is especially utilized in animal nutrition that typically includes ammonia, urea and biuret that don't seem to be protein however are often reborn into the protein. Placental mammal producers are awake to the actual fact that urea is the common supply of non-protein nitrogen in feed; it contains 46.7% nitrogen compared to sixteen personality factor questionnaire for several proteins.

The growth in dairy industry is the major factor accelerating the growth of the feed non-protein nitrogen market. Furthermore, increasing RD investment in animal feed industry, growing cattle population, increasing meat consumption are also expected to drive the growth of the feed non-protein nitrogen market. However, risk associated with the toxicity of global feed non-protein nitrogen market and strict government rules regulations will restrains the feed non-protein nitrogen market, whereas, lactose intolerant people will challenge market growth.

Scope of the Feed Non-Protein Nitrogen Market Report: 

The feed non-protein nitrogen market is segmented on the basis of type, form and livestock. The growth among segments helps you analyse niche pockets of growth and strategies to approach the market and determine your core application areas and the difference in your target markets.

  • On the basis of type, the feed non-protein nitrogen market is segmented into urea, ammonia and others. Other segment is further segmented into monoammonium phosphate, diammonium phosphate, and biuret.
  • On the basis of form, the feed non-protein nitrogen market is segmented into dry and liquid. Dry is further segmented into prills and granules.
  • On the basis of livestock, the feed non-protein nitrogen market is segmented into dairy cattle, beef cattle, sheep and goat and others. Others segment is further segmented into non-ruminants.
